Carsten Dominik <dominik@science.uva.nl> writes:

> On Jul 1, 2007, at 1:35, Patrick Drechsler wrote:
>
>> inserting a `CLOCK: => 2:30' manually works fine: Cool feature.
>>
>> How do I insert something like the above with the attribute "Jan
>> 2007" so that following org-tables notice it when being updated?
>
> You cannot.  Just clock in and out of the item with
>
> C-c C-x C-i  C-c C-x C-o
>
> and then adjust the time stamps to be in the correct month and to
> have the right time difference.
